我正在Flex 4.5中构建表单构建器。为此,我需要有关在运行时上传图像的帮助,以便任何用户只需将光标放在图像上的特定位置,并且能够从本地文件系统上传任何图像。
答案 0 :(得分:0)
也许尝试使用原生扩展或本机进程。但这只适用于AIR。 这是一个简单的例子: http://thanksmister.com/2011/03/16/upload-s3-curl-air-nativeprocess/
我希望这会有所帮助:)
你能描述一下你想要做的更多吗?
答案 1 :(得分:0)
这很简单
private function browseForFile():void
{
fr = new FileReference();
fr.addEventListener(Event.SELECT,handleBrowseForFileSelected);
fr.browse([]);
}
protected function handleBrowseForFileSelected(event:Event):void
{
fr.removeEventListener(Event.SELECT,handleBrowseForFileSelected);
fr.upload( ...)
}
fr.upload中的根据需要填写参数,基本上是你要将文件上传到的URLRequest。